About The Position

Peraton is seeking a Technical Project Manager (TPM) to manage projects, ensuring adherence to timeline, budget, and scope. The TPM will be assigned specific projects by the Program Manager, overseeing requirements, scope, budget, schedule, and performance. This role involves monitoring, adjusting, and reporting on project status, providing interim progress reviews, and assisting with the implementation of program policies, standards, and methodologies. The TPM will develop or supervise the preparation of studies, reports, and acquisition documents, working from the latest client-approved Project Management Processes (PMP). The PMP is an evolutionary document updated at least annually and as project changes occur. The position is contingent on contract award.
